Swedish chess legend Ulf Andersson was a positional genius with a crystal-clear style. In his prime, in the 1970s and 80s, he rose to the number 4 spot of the FIDE world rankings because he almost never lost a game and kept scoring wins from quiet positions. But every now and then, he found himself in a position on the board that demanded an attack. And then he would strike! He was fierce and decisive, showcasing his phenomenal talent and his incredible ability to sense any imbalance on the board. Ulf - The Attacker is an amazing collection of thrilling games! Ulf is widely regarded as one of the most likable figures in the chess world. He is consistently humble, generous with his time, and known for his exceptional sportsmanship. But at the board, he was merciless in his games against Anatoly Karpov, Viktor Korchnoi, Bent Larsen, and Lajos Portisch, to name a few of the chess stars that got crushed in an attack. This book is both entertaining and instructive. Ulf Andersson's fluid attacking game will undoubtedly influence your own thinking about chess.
